What is the inverse of the function f(x) = 2x – 10? A. h(x) = 2x - 5
B. h(x) = 2x + 5 C. h(x) = 1/2x - 5 D. h(x) = 1/2x - 10

Answer:

f^-1(x)=1/2x+5

Step-by-step explanation:

y=2x-10

inteechange 'y' with 'x'

x=2y-10

make 'y' the subject

2y=x+10

divide by 2both sides

y=(x+10)÷2

y=1/2x+5

f^-1(x)=1/2x+5
